Major: Chemistry (This Major's Salary over time)
Over all I really like ASU. Its a smaller school in a smaller city so keep that in mind. That comes with good & bad things. The good thing is you really get to know your professors, bad thing is nobody knows where it is you go when you tell them. For a smaller school it has a good reputation with employers at least in science fields, not sure about the rest. The campus isnt that big. Even with pretty crowded parking you can easily walk from one end to the other in 10 minutes. But the buildings all seem really new. They just remodeled the library to look badass. The gym used to suck but they are building on to it, it has taken way to long but looks like it will be top notch. The old dorms if you get stuck in them are pretty bad. But they have built 2 huge new ones that are private bedrooms that are really nice, so try to get those. They are building a new one right now too that looks nice, but I hear its shared bedrooms. The school has cheap tuition & tons of financial aide, the endowment here is bigger than most every other small state school, alot West Texas of oil money families have supported it. The sports are NCAA D2 which kind of sucks, but they have nice facilities and are pretty successful, I like to watch them. Social life is, well complicated. I've made alot of friends because I'm pretty social, but have heard others complain so IDK. I've heard everything from its a crazy party school to the most boring school around, doesnt seem like it can be both so all I can say is I've had fun & its probably like most schools. If you want to party you can find one anytime, if not and your socially awkward or judgmental to begin with you might have trouble. Can say I've never seen any drinking or drugs on campus so if its not your think you should be ok. The off campus apartments, a whole different story. But really depends what you want. There are alot of clubs on campus & comedy shows, concerts, however frats & sororities are not very big at all. Only a couple small ones. I find the school work challenging but I have a harder major. Some of my friends in easier majors do not seem to study as often as I have to. Over all good place, but I guess check it out first.
